Started in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been engaged to reducing the time to market for innovators innovating new medical devices. The company differentiates itself by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times spanning 1 to 3 days—an achievement unreachable with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ard observed the crucial need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for active development programs developing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is fundamental in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old considerable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Complementing rout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Why Medical Device Sterilization Matters

Infection prevention remains a core component of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Correct sterilization of medical devices dramatically re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ers simultaneously. Deficient sterilization can give rise to outbreaks of dangerous di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Methods of Medical Device Sterilization

The science behind sterilization has progressed substantially over the last century, leveraging a variety of methods suited to a range of types of devices and materials. Some of the most predominantly chosen techniques include:

Steam-Based Sterilization (Autoclaving)

Autoclaving remains the most frequent and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is fast, reasonably priced, and eco-friendly,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Advanced Trends in Medical Device Sterilization

As the industry moves forward, several key trends are guiding sterilization processes:

Eco-Friendly Sterilization Techniques

As ecological guidelines heighten, organizations are rapidly embracing sustainable sterilization options. Strategies include reducing reliance on noxious ch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ring eco-friendly packaging strategies, and optimizing electricity use in sterilization processes.

State-of-the-art Materials and Device Complexity

The rise of advanced med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ization systems capable of handling elaborate materials. Evolution in sterilization include methods including low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ging vulnerable components.

Digital Traceability and Verification

With advances in digital technology, monitoring of sterilization protocols is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er exhaustive docum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time prompts, significantly mitigating human error and enhancing patient safety.
